Transaction 3a61fcb3da66c679102bb5776d79e855503ddedcef7171b128974dbcc2d43c33

1 Input
2 Outputs
  • 3a61fcb3da66c679102bb5776d79e855503ddedcef7171b128974dbcc2d43c33:0
  • value  9427
    address  17NsJHfukPZx9QEb7xKCYDh7xscNWRaTYx
  • 3a61fcb3da66c679102bb5776d79e855503ddedcef7171b128974dbcc2d43c33:1
  • value  40000
    address  13p7eyehUqRes2hUusAyNhEdGg1eVzwTNT